Counseling Services
Personal Counseling
The school counselor is available to assist students with a wide range of personal problems. The counselor is not there to make decisions for the students but can provide information which will help the students arrive at their own decisions.
Confidentiality: When speaking to the counselor, it is important for the students to know that the information they give the counselor in confidential. Confidential. means that the counselor will not repeat the information to anyone including parents. Confidentiality is a trust issue and is important for the student-counselor relationship.
Limits to Confidentiality : If a student informs the counselor that they plan on hurting someone or him/her self or if a student informs the counselor that he/she knows of someone that is hurting others or him/her self then by law the counselor must break confidentiality and notify the correct authorities.
Senior Guidance
College Preparation: Seniors that plan on attending college next fall should be doing the following:
- Choose a college.
- research your options
- compare your choices
2. Fill out applications.
- apply to at least three colleges (don't forget to notify colleges of your final decision)
- you can download most college applications or use the Texas Common Application
- along with application you will need to include the following: letters of recommendation (3), resume, scholarship or financial aid information, transcript, and test scores
3. Take or retake the SAT, ACT, and THEA.
- check individual college for requirements
4. Visit college campus.
- meet with an admission counselor
- verify admission requirements
- determine actual college costs and ask about financial aid
- take a campus tour
- investigate academic program
- find out about housing
5. Apply for housing.
6. Apply for financial aid.
- start gathering information now
- all student going to college should fill out the FASFA in January
- go to the fasfa web site and set up a pin www.fafsa.ed.gov
7. Apply for Scholarships.
Junior Guidance
College Preparation: Juniors that plan on attending college should be doing the following:
- Take the PSAT for practice and scholarship opportunities.
- Research college options.
- Research career and major options.
- Start planning for financial aid.
- Study and take the SAT and ACT.
- Continue to work hard in your classes and keep up your GPA.
- Continue or start extra-curricular activities or community service. Colleges are looking for well rounded students.
